Musabani block
East Singhbum district, Jharkhand · 52 villages
Villages
52
7 created since 2011
Average change
+12.1%
across 35 measurable villages
Population 2011 → 2020
48,071 → 53,140
compared villages only

Blocks are the administrative tier between district and village. The block a village belongs to comes from the Local Government Directory via the 2020 survey, so it reflects boundaries as of 2020, not 2011.
